Correction circuit costs right, but correction construction costs garage under house DGA not
Dga X is the sole shareholder and director of A BV. The DGA has a racing license. The DGA and his partner live in a house of which they each own 50%. Prior to the purchase of the house, a permit was requested and granted for the construction of an underground garage annex showroom with an area of approximately 400 m2. The garage has its own entrance and is accessible from the outside via a private elevator. The construction costs of the garage totaling € 342,598 were paid by A BV. The building permit has been applied for by A BV and the contract has been concluded by A BV. A lease has been drawn up between the DGA as landlord and A BV as tenant.
